Music burned to CD skips when played

When I burned my playlist to a CD, the music skips when replayed in my car.  Any suggestions?

Make sure you are using CD-R blanks, not CD-RW, since the latter often have problems in normal CD players.
Also use a nice low burn speed, such as 2x.  This selection can be made on the dialog that comes up when you request the Burn.

  • CD-Rs I burn on my iMac skip when played back

    Hi there, when I create songs in Garageband and then "send to iTunes" and burn the disc, many of the songs skip randomly. I've tried playing back the disc in multiple stereos and computers, and it's the same thing. The discs are not scratched. What could be the problem?

    Two things to try:
    Unless you're using a high quality brand, change the brand you're using (the Superdrives are very finicky about the media - mine only likes Verbatim), and
    burn at the slowest speed available (which cuts down on burn errors).
